Output d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73:75

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3d0d6758ae6b11fa26547fe5bb0941b2ab2769116a4aa85b6d2a1d91a61d46c
address
bc1p60gdvav2u6c3lgn9gll9hvy5rv4tya53z6j24pdk62sajxnp63kq89xv3y
transaction
d5f86e8e9d0759d6903afddd93efdaf5dc548131c8b1bcaabcb9c92664658a73
confirmations
16900
spent
true